Dr. Furman Brodie and the Brooklyn Presbyterian Church [1]

Dr. Furman Brodie [2], pastor of Brooklyn Presbyterian Church during the 1920s.

SECOND WARD ALUMNI ASSOCIATION.

Right: Brooklyn Presbyterian Church [3], organized 1911, and the manse.

FIRST UNITED PRESBYTERIAN CHURCH ARCHIVES.
